Contents
    1. 日時
    2. 場所
    3. 費用
    4. 定員
  1. 内容
    1. 10:00~12:00:仕切り直しのRails3初心者レッスン<その1>(by つじた)
    2. 13:00~14:30:テスト駆動開発導入(仮題)(by yalabさん)
    3. 15:00~16:00:15分でわかる〜(LTふう3本立て)
  2. 参加申し込み/キャンセル
  3. その他注意など
  4. KPT
    1. Keep
    2. Problem
    3. Try
  5. 今回出てきたコードたち
    1. テスト駆動開発入門資料
    2. 仕切り直しのRails3初心者レッスン
    3. 15分でわかるgithub
    4. 15分でわかるgit入門
    5. 15分でわかるzsh
  6. 3時のおやつ

第4回勉強会

日時

2011年1月29日(土)10時〜16時(お昼休憩1時間あり)

場所

精華学習ルーム(旧大阪市立精華小学校):地下鉄なんば駅

http://www.kyoiku-shinko.jp/sisetu/11/index.html

入口はマルイ横の商店街を入ってほんのちょっと行った右です。 cafe streetとかいうT字路のつき当たり。 洋服屋と金券ショップの間に鉄格子の門がありますので、そこから入ってください。

費用

500円

定員

20名程度

内容

10:00~12:00:仕切り直しのRails3初心者レッスン<その1>(by つじた)

初心者レッスンを仕切り直して、演習中心の4回シリーズにします。 ひととおりRailsを触って、理解はざっくりでいいので、これでもRailsできてしまうんだという面白さをお伝えしたいと思います。 今回のシリーズ終了後も、要望があればMinami.rbの定番ネタとして続けて行くつもりです。(Railsはどんどん進化しますしね。)

<その1:1/29>

  • Railsで何をする?どうしてRails?
  • DBをRails(ブラウザ)から扱うということ
  • 作ってみよう事始め
  • プロジェクトとテーブル
  • Railsはどんなふうに働いてる?

<その2:2/26予定>

  • 実はURLが大事
  • リレーションを考える

<その3:3/26予定>

  • 日本語対応
  • 見た目をキレイに

<その4:4/23予定>

  • プラグインを使う
  • ちょっとRubyに働いてもらう
  • herokuに公開しよう

13:00~14:30:テスト駆動開発導入(仮題)(by yalabさん)


15:00~16:00:15分でわかる〜(LTふう3本立て)

  • 15分でわかるgit(by うえださん)
  • 15分でわかるgithub(by つじた)
  • 15分でわかる zsh(by mollifier)

参加申し込み/キャンセル

その他注意など

  • ネット、PC環境はありません。e-mobileなどお持ちの方はご持参いただきますようお願いいたします。
  • RailsとRubyの演習があります。PCを持参される方は、あらかじめRuby1.9以上、Rails3.0以上をインストールして来られることをオススメします。

(参照:Railsインストール手順 for 初級者http://d.hatena.ne.jp/satomicchy/20100905/1283700944

どうしてもうまくいかなければ、当日またはMLでフォローします(してもらいます)ので、がんばってください!

KPT

Keep

  • 手を動かすこと
  • おやつ

Problem

  • 全体的にペースが早い
  • リファレンスマニュアルが見られる環境(ネット環境がない)
  • 事前準備(インストール)の資料がない

Try

  • ネット環境はe-mobile共有など案内する
  • わからないことがあれば、MLに入ってメールしてみる
  • インストール手順について、OSごとにおいおいまとめる。

Linux(ubuntu10.04)環境構築手順:http://d.hatena.ne.jp/satomicchy/20101210/1291988033

今回出てきたコードたち

テスト駆動開発入門資料

http://www.slideshare.net/yalab/ss-6749458

仕切り直しのRails3初心者レッスン

  • 資料

http://www.slideshare.net/satomicchy/rails-lesson1

  • コマンド一覧
$ rails new minamirbist
$ cd minamirbist/
$ rails generate scaffold member name:string address:string email:string twitter_id:string blog:string birthday:date pr:string
$ rails generate scaffold event date_on:date name:string place:string contents:string
 (rails generate scaffold entry event:references member:references)
$ rails generate scaffold entry event_id:integer member_id:integer
$ rake db:migrate
$ rails console
$ rails s
$ rails generate -h
$ rails generate scaffold -h
$ rake routes
  • 今シリーズで作るアプリの画面遷移とテーブル図

http://qwik.jp/minamirb/57.download/minamirbist.tiff

15分でわかるgithub

http://prezi.com/hueyuh99y3vt/15github/

15分でわかるgit入門

http://www.slideshare.net/to_ueda/git-6821390

15分でわかるzsh

http://d.hatena.ne.jp/mollifier/20110207/p1

3時のおやつ

  • FLAVORのメープルシフォンケーキ

http://www.flavor.co.jp/

  • モンロワールのチョコレート

https://www.monloire.co.jp/

Last modified: 2011-02-11 Attached files total: 3MB